    Ted Markland (January 15, 1933 – December 18, 2011) was an American character actor. [1] Markland is best known for the role of Reno in the NBC television series The High Chaparral. [2] Markland had a small part in the television Western Bat Masterson (S2E21 as Rancher "Lem Taylor").
